M-Pref is a series of workshops gathering together researchers interested in different aspects of preference handling in different situations and theories. It aims to offer a friendly atmosphere where participants can exchange about the latest advances of the field.

List of Topics
Possible topics mainly include the following aspects, but are not especially restricted to them if you think your contribution with the general topic of preference handling
- elicitation of preferences
- Fairness and ethic in preference modelling
- (statistical) learning of preferences
- modeling and representation of preferences,
- aggregation of preferences
- reasoning with preferences
- explaining preferences
- axiomatization of preference models
- preferences in other domains such as
- game theory
- decision theory
- computational social choice
- combinatorial optimization
- non-monotonic reasoning
- automated problem solving
- planning and robotics,
- perception and natural language understanding,
- ...
- use and application of preferences in
- decision making,
- database querying,
- web search,
- personalized human-computer interaction,
- personalized recommender systems,
- e-commerce,
- multi-agent systems,
- sustainable development issues,
- healthcare applications
